Engineered for excellence, this robust connector measures 3 inches in inner diameter and is 3 inches long, making it a perfect fit for a variety of applications. Key Features: 4-Ply Reinforcement: Hand-wrapped construction provides exceptional durability, allowing the hose to withstand extreme temperatures and heavy-duty pressure without compromising integrity. Temperature Range: Rated for temperatures ranging from -65°F to 350°F, ensuring reliable performance in demanding environments. SAE J20 Compliance: Meets or exceeds industry standards for coolant service, making it a trustworthy choice for your vehicle's cooling system. UV and Ozone Resistant: Designed to resist environmental factors, ensuring longevity and reliability over time. Versatile Options: Available in various configurations including straight sections, transition hoses, hump hoses, and both 45 and 90-degree elbows for complete customization.
